Off-duty cop fatally shoots man armed with BB gun after confrontation outside Staten Island diner
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

A man with a significant mental health history armed with a realistic-looking BB gun was fatally shot by an off-duty police officer outside a popular Staten Island diner on Friday night, according to sources and the NYPD.

Bullets flew just after 8 p.m. at the well-known Andrew’s Diner on Hylan Boulevard in Eltingville, according to the NYPD.

Diners alerted cops that a man with a gun was menacing the eatery, according to sources.

The gun-wielding man —  whom sources identified as Jesse Campbell, 44 — then had a confrontation with two off-duty NYPD officers behind the diner, during which he pointed the supposed weapon at them, according to sources.

Police have not yet confirmed the man’s name.

During the confrontation, one of the off-duty officers, a female detective with the Internal Affairs Bureau, fired multiple rounds at the suspect, striking him throughout the body, according to the NYPD and sources.

Police have a video that showed off-duty officers directing Campbell multiple times to drop the gun before the fatal shooting, according to sources.

Campbell was taken to Staten Island University Hospital, where he was pronounced dead, sources said.

Campbell had “significant” mental health issues, sources said, adding that he had allegedly told his mother and sister earlier in the day that he intended to be killed by police.

“It looks like suicide by cop,” a police source said.

A hyper-realistic BB gun was recovered at the scene, according to sources and the NYPD.

Photos shared by the NYPD on social media show a black gun with a piece of tape around its grip.

Photos from the scene show detectives analyzing a pool of blood in the road near an abandoned black baseball cap.

“The men and women of the NYPD are never truly off the job,” Assistant Chief Melissa Eger said at a press conference on Staten Island late Friday night. “Tonight we saw that firsthand.

“Two off-duty officers bravely ran towards danger and took immediate action.”

Eger stressed that the officers attempted to “de-escalate” the “dangerous and unpredictable situation.”

The suspect also has a criminal history in the state of New York, the NYPD said.

“We are aware of the incident that took place on William Avenue in Great Kills earlier this evening,” Staten Island Borough President Vito Fossella said in a statement Friday night.

“It appears that an off-duty member of the NYPD heroically stepped up to keep the public safe, and we are thankful.”

The NYPD advised in a post on X that traffic delays in the vicinity, as well as increased presence of emergency vehicles, should be expected.
